A pronominal verb phrase combines a verb with a preposition or other particle and always uses a reflexive pronoun. (e.g., Se dio cuenta del problema.)
pronominal verb phrase
a. to stay in the lane
Quédate en el carril en el que estás porque tienes que girar a la derecha.Stay in the lane you are in because you have to turn right.
b. to stay in one's lane
Si hay poca visibilidad, es mejor quedarse en el carril y no adelantar.If there's poor visibility, it's best to stay in your lane and not to overtake.
